Mammograms are all about detecting breast cancer so that early intervention can take place. This life-saving screening can help uncover lumps which could point to serious medical issues. Digital and traditional film are two of the methods that have been used for years, however, there is another technique that may prove to be even more beneficial for you: The 3D mammogram. 3D mammograms have a number of advantages over more traditional versions that you should know about. Women with ovarian cancer, more than with other gynecological tumors, often are not diagnosed until the cancer is advanced and harder to treat. Symptoms can be minimal or mistaken for other issues.
Traditional forms of treatment like surgical removal of the tumor or ovaries and chemotherapy – which can work well if the cancer is found early – may not eradicate the cancerous cells by the time that they’ve spread outside the ovaries. Read More»
